Special Confection for Scoliosis
Tradition:
Western
Source / Author:
Wirtzung
Herb Name | Latin | Amount |
|---|---|---|
Betonica officinalis | ||
Lavendula stoechas | ||
Oreganum marjorana | ||
Commiphora mukul | ||
Pistacia lentiscus | ||
Ruta graveolens | ||
Cinnamonum zeylanicum | 2 drams. ea. | |
Acorus calamus | 3 drams | |
Artichoke roots | Cynara scolymus | 1 1⁄2 drams |
Salvia hemotodes | ||
Centaurea behen | ||
Crocus sativus | ||
Myristica fragrans | 3 scruples ea. | |
Glycyrrhiza glabra | 4 scruples | |
Zingiber officinalis | 12 oz. | |
Saccharum alba | 2 oz. |
Preparation:
Powder the herbs and beat with the Sugar to form a Confection according to Art.
Function:
Relieves Wind, stops Spasms, moves Qi and Blood
Use:
1. ‘Crookedness of the Back’;
2. Scoliosis;
3. Spasm and Contraction of the muscle of the Back
Dose:
A piece the size of a Nutmeg at least twice weekly; Best taken daily throughout the year.
Comment:
This is an elegant and well composed formula for its intended purpose. By the addition of the Red and White Behen, it appears it could be of Arab origin, but this is uncertain.
Cautions:
None noted
